Preferred

  • Support new system launch to Telus Health pension administration solution for managing and paying members and pensioners.
  • Participate in processing of pension benefit calculations in accordance with the pension plan text and regulatory requirements.
  • Maintain and reconcile system data for annuitants, withdrawals and valuation reports.
  • Prepare, verify and file tax and other legislative and regulatory requirements (AIRs,T4As, PAs, PSPAs, PARs) Participate in Processing of monthly pension payroll.
  • Prepare and issue annual member pension statements.
  • Completion and testing of internal controls to ensure compliance with annual Sarbanes-Oxley certificates, including updating, testing and validation of departmental processes and procedures.
  • Liaise with external auditors for financial statement preparation and verification.
  • Communicate with members, employers, union representatives, plan actuaries and custodians regarding benefit entitlements; administration procedures and interpretations of plan provisions.
  • Other duties as assigned

Why Work With Us

Altair is a global technology company providing software and cloud solutions in the areas of data analytics, product development, and high-performance computing (HPC). Altair enables organizations in nearly every industry to compete more effectively in a connected world, while creating a more sustainable future. With more than 3,000 engineers, scientists, and creative thinkers in 25 countries, we help solve our customer’s toughest challenges and deliver unparalleled service, helping the innovators innovate, drive better decisions, and turn today’s problems into tomorrow’s opportunities.

Our vision is to transform customer decision making with data analytics, simulation, and high-performance computing.

For more than 30 years, we have been helping our customers integrate electronics and controls with mechanical design to expand product value, develop AI, simulation and data-driven digital twins to drive better decisions, and deliver advanced HPC and cloud solutions to support unlimited idea exploration.
